I am objecting to the application in its proposed form. I am concerned about the amount of land it's going to take, from what was made clear to the public, it's agricultural-grade soil, and as the current war in Ukraine made clear, fertile, crop-bearing soil is of great value to the country, and essential for alleviating agricultural dependence on other states. I am also worried about the carbon footprint of the scheme, which not only hinders the pursuit of Carbon Zero goal, but potentially cancels itself out. From what I read about the technology, it is outdated, and burdened with significant risks (fires). Finally, it is only profitable for out-of-state entities (Spanish owners, Chinese manufacturers), does nothing for local economy.
